I'm not sure there is a major difference between the two from a Disney perspective. Crowds will be low both weeks. The weather will be about the same. You are not there during either MLK or Presidents' Day. I don't see any rehabs that will be impacted by choosing either week.

If you are flying, I would choose based on what rates or flights are cheaper/more convenient.
 
The only difference is that the HS Cheerleading Nationals is always at the end of the first full week in February. That shouldn't affect crowds in the parks too much, but it will affect those staying at the affected resorts.

That said, we were there both weeks in 2014 and there was no noticeable difference in our 2 week stay.

We have gone both weeks. In January 2011 we went the last week of the month.
It was a perfect trip with beautiful weather and low crowds. I remember that week was all predicted to be like 1's and 2's.. And it was definitely our best trip in terms of lower crowds. The first week of February in 2012 was similar for us crowd wise but, it was busier.

We are going back the first week of February in 2016. The crowd calendars are not 1's and 2's anymore.. In fact a few of those days that week are predicted to be moderate to higher crowds, certainly not low.
From what I have been hearing from friends and family who have traveled that time period in the past couple years, things have changed a lot since our 2011/2012 trips.. Things are much busier. Maybe compared to other times of year the crowds aren't bad but, just like with September every year those less crowded times get more and more crowded.

As for crowd calendars... those are based on wait times, and not actual bodies in the park. Since they are only stand by wait times, it is a partial snapshot of actual crowds. This is becoming an issue for them. Don't know how else they can figure it out though.
